Over the past few months, I’ve become aware of some issues with existing property law and rights of those who buy new builds ðŸ . Issues in both Priors Hall and Little Stanion have made clear to me we need reforms.
Having met with residents in both areas, I’ve got a few ideas of how the issues can be addressed (none of these are an instant fix but they would help). If I were your MP, I’d hit the ground running by:
✅Submitting Written Parliamentary Questions on the issue to achieve wider recognition of the problem and build a better understanding of the national scale of the problem;
✅Holding a backbench debate on proper regulation of developers: this would be with the intention of putting pressure on the government (whoever wins on 12th December) to take legislative action;
✅ Seeking to agree some text with the Table Office in Parliament and attaching this to any relevant government bill in a future Queen's speech; and
✅ If Labour form the next government, set up a meeting with the Housing Minister, John Healey MP, local residents and developers so that the Minister could hear the issues directly and - hopefully - be motivated to take formal action.
